Final Women's Soccer Regular-Season Home Matches This Weekend

Rolla, Mo. – The Missouri S&T women's soccer team will make its final 2018 regular season home appearances this weekend (Oct. 12 and 14) as the Miners host a pair of Great Lakes Valley Conference (GLVC) opponents at the S&T Soccer Field.  The Miners commence the weekend's action this Friday (Oct. 12) taking on the McKendree Bearcats in a 5 p.m. (CT) contest and then wrap up the home portion of their regular season slate pn Sunday (Oct. 14) as the Illinois Springfield (UIS) Prairie Stars visit S&T for a 12 p.m. (CT) matchup.

2018 Record: Missouri S&T improved to 3-7-1 overall and 2-5-1 in the GLVC following a 1-0 conference road victory over Truman State this last Sunday (Oct. 7) at TSU's Bulldog Soccer Park in Kirksville, Mo., which snapped a three-match losing string.  The Miners, who suffered a 3-0 league home setback to Missouri-St. Louis this past Friday (Oct. 5) at the S&T Soccer Field in Rolla, sports a 0-5-1 record at home while registering a 2-2-0 on the road and a 1-0-0 ledger in neutral site matches this campaign.
 
S&T Head Coach – Joe McCauley (Louisville, 1992), Ninth season, 41-88-13 (.335).  McCauley, who's currently in his ninth season at Missouri S&T this fall after arriving prior to the 2010 season, led the Miners to a pair of Great Lakes Valley Conference (GLVC) Tournament appearances and a GLVC Tourney Championship match outing in 2014.  He guided the 2014 S&T squad to its first conference title match following a tourney opening-round win at Bellarmine and a victory in. penalty kick shootout over defending champion Quincy.  Prior to S&T, McCauley served six seasons (2004-09) as the head coach at NCAA Division II Eckerd College after spending five seasons (1998-02) as the goalkeeper coach at NCAA Division I Northern Illinois where he assisted in guiding the Huskies to a 1998 Mid-American Conference (MAC) Championship title.  McCauley coached at fellow Great Lakes Valley Conference (GLVC) foe Bellarmine (Ky.) from 1991-97, which included taking over as the Knights' head coach in 1992.  McCauley began his coaching career in 1990 at NCAA-I Louisville instructing the Cardinal goalkeepers.       
 
This Week's Opponents
     *McKendree: The Bearcats are 10-1-1 overall and 6-1-1 in the GLVC this season to date after winning their fifth straight match with a 1-0 league road victory over Quincy (Ill.) this last Sunday (Oct. 7) at QU's Legends Stadium.  McKendree, which is coached by 20th-year head coach Tim Strange, tallied a 1-0 conference road win against Illinois Springfield last Friday (Oct.5) at UIS' Kiwanis Stadium in Springfield, Ill.  The Bearcats, who were 15-3-3 overall with a 9-2-3 GLVC record a season ago, are 6-0-1 on the road and 4-1-0 at home this campaign.  All-Time Series – Tied at 4-4-1 -- 1-1-1 Home, 3-3-0 Away, 0-0-0 Neutral; Last Meeting - L 1-0 OT (10/20/17 at McKendree).

     *Illinois SpringfieldThe Prairie Stars, who are presently 1-9-2 overall and 1-7-0 in the GLVC this season, are midst a seven-matching losing streak after suffering a 1-0 home league loss to William Jewell this past Sunday (Oct. 7) at UIS' Kiwanis Stadium in Springfield, Ill.  UIS, which fell 1-0 at home to McKendree last Friday (Oct. 5) in conference action, is 1-2-2 at home, 0-6-0 on the road, and 0-1-0 at neutral sites this fall.  The Prairie Stars, who are directed by third-year head coach Erin Egolf, visit Drury this Friday (Oct. 12) in a GLVC encounter at DU's Curry Sports Complex-Harrison Stadium in Springfield, Mo., before facing Missouri S&T this Sunday (Oct. 14) in Rolla, Mo.  Last season, UIS posted a 9-6-4 overall mark and went 6-5-3 in the GLVC.  All-Time Series – S&T trails 5-4-0 -- 2-2-0 Home, 2-3-0 Away, 1-0-0 Neutral; Last Meeting - L 2-0 (9/17/17 at Illinois Springfield) 
   
Miner Notes: Kayla Foster's (Sand Springs, Okla./Charles Page) match-winning goal in S&T's 1-0 conference victory at Truman State last Friday (Oct. 5) was the third of her career.  The junior forward netted two game-winning scores in 13 appearances as a freshman in the 2016 season.  Foster has accumulated 20 career points (10-0=20) in 38 appearances, which includes two points (1-0=2) in 11 outings this fall ... Sophomore goalkeeper Kristin Steins (Ballwin, Mo./Parkway South) notched her second shutout of this season with a complete-match five saves in the Miners' 1-0 win at Truman State.  Steins' initial shutout this campaign occurred in S&T's 1-0 league decision at Drury (9/23) with four stops in 90 minutes of action ...  The Miners' two road victories (2-2-0) this fall to date represents the program's most since 2014 when S&T went 3-7-0 in away encounters ... The Miners have outperformed their opponent in corner kicks this season with a 43-32 lead, which includes a 30-16 first-half advantage.  

Home Finales: The Miners have registered a 21-13-2 record (.611) in their final regular-season home matches dating back to the 1982 season.  S&T has compiled a 2-6-2 mark in its last 10 home finale outings, which includes a 1-4-1 ledger in its last five such appearances.  The Miners earned a 1-0 win over Wisconsin-Parkside in last season's (10/25) final home contest to snap a three-match losing skid.  

2018 Seniors To Be Honored: Prior to this Sunday's (Oct. 14) home-finale match, S&T will recognize its seven senior student-athletes on the 2018 team in a special ceremony.  Comprising the group are goalkeeper Liz Carrano (Gurnee, Ill./Warren Township), midfielder Lauren Tolan (Columbia, Ill./Columbia), midfielder Morgan Sikora (Highland, Ill./Highland), defender Andrea Aller (Bettendorf, Iowa/Pleasant Valley), defender Carli Tastad (Millstadt, Ill./Belleville West), midfielder Taylor Vollmer (Belleville, Ill./Belleville West), and midfielder Mikaela Mockenhaupt (Oswego, Ill./Oswego).

2018 GLVC Women's Soccer Preseason Poll: S&T was tabbed 14th in the 2018 Great Lakes Valley Conference (GLVC) Coaches Preseason Poll as the Miners earned 14 points.  McKendree was picked to win the conference with 159 points and six first-place votes while Quincy garnered five first-place votes and garnered 151 points.  Bellarmine, which placed third, received the remaining three first-place votes and totaled 149 points.   Maryville (130 pts.) and Truman State (117 pts.) rounded out the top five, respectively.  Claiming the sixth-place spot was Rockhurst, which received 106 points, followed by Southern Indiana (103 pts.), Indianapolis (81 pts.), Illinois Springfield (68 pts.), and Lewis (56 pts.).  Missouri-St. Louis (52 pts.), Drury (50 pts.), and William Jewell (38 pts.) occupied places 11th through 13th.  The 14 league coaches weren't allowed to vote for their own teams.  

2018 S&T Roster: Missouri S&T's 2018 active roster consists of seven seniors, 11 juniors, seven sophomores, and four freshmen.  Twelve of the 29 student-athletes play at the defender position while nine others are midfielders, five goalkeepers, and three forwards.  Ten individuals hail from the state of Illinois while eight are from Missouri.  Serving as S&T's captains for the 2018 season are junior midfielder Morgan Sikora (Highland, Ill./Highland), Taylor Vollmer (Belleville, Ill./Belleville West), and Mikaela Mockenhaupt (Oswego, Ill./Oswego).  
 
All-Time Record: The 2018 campaign represents S&T's 37th season of intercollegiate women's soccer competition since the program's inception in 1982.  The Miners have presently amassed a 222-361-47 record (.3xx) to date.  S&T has recorded six 10 or more victories in a season – 10-5 (1983), 12-7 (1986), 12-6-2 (1994), 15-3-1 (1997), 10-7 (1998), and 10-7-1 (1999).

Up Next: The Miners will embark on a three-match conference road swing over the next two weeks to conclude their 2018 regular season schedule, starting next Friday, Oct. 19, against the Lewis Flyers in Romeoville, Ill.  A 7:30 p.m. (CT) start time is set for the GLVC match at LU's Lewis Stadium.   S&T then travels to Indianapolis, Ind., next Sunday, Oct. 21, for a 11 a.m. (CT) league tilt versus the Indianapolis Greyhounds at UI's Key Stadium.  The Miners' regular-season finale occurs on Wednesday, Oct. 24, when S&T visits the Maryville Saints in a 2:30 p.m. (CT) conference outing at St. Louis, Mo.
